The beginning of false
Not a straight line, but a series of calculated transitions from tech to sales to fashion. With a background in tech, Kanika Gusain, founder of False, has a journey defined by constant flux, driven by motion, adaptation, and instinct. What remained constant was her love for fashion, creativity, and attention to detail. In June 2025, she launched False, an evolving label built on a clear vision to create something bold, expressive, and globally relevant.
